Transponder key programming
Transponder keys are keys that have an electronic microchip embedded inside their head. These chips are able to transmit and receive radio frequencies. When a car is equipped with transponder, the chip of the key transmits a signal to the antenna ring on the engine control unit. The ECU receives these signals and begins the car key spares. This technology was designed to protect against theft of cars by making it difficult for thieves to open cars without the correct key.
Some people try to save money by getting a pre-cut spare key from a locksmith however, they should be wary of used keys since they could already be programmed to an alternative vehicle. This type of key can only be used to start the vehicle it was programmed to and can cause damage when used on a different vehicle. A professional locksmith can make spare car key an extra key for you.
Transponder key programming is a process that requires a lot time and patience, and can be difficult for a common person to accomplish at home. It requires specialized tools, and a deep understanding of automotive electronic systems. There are numerous online guides to assist with the process, however they vary in terms of complexity. Some are easy to do, while others need a professional.
The most common way to program a transponder is to use an Hex-key. This method is simple and is attainable by most people, but it does not work on all vehicles. Certain manufacturers have proprietary technology that allows dealerships to program new keys.
The EEPROM method requires specialized equipment and is more complicated. It involves reading the key data from the car's microchip, and then reprogramming the new key. This is a highly risky procedure that can damage the microchip's data. An experienced professional with expertise in automotive electronics should be able to perform this task.
